Understanding Local Meteorological Patterns

Concord Township experiences distinct seasonal shifts that demand close monitoring of barometric pressure, wind speeds, and frontal boundaries moving down from Canada and up the Atlantic coastline. Daily high and low temperatures fluctuate significantly depending on cloud cover and prevailing wind directions across the Kennebec River valley region.

Precipitation chances are calculated based on atmospheric moisture content and radar returns tracking storm systems across New England. Residents rely on these metrics to anticipate slick winter roads, heavy autumn rainfall, or sudden summer thunderstorms that can impact rural transit routes and power grid reliability.
